Tube ticket staff rally at Parliament
London Underground workers ramp up their fight to keep ticket offices open
London Underground workers will protest outside Parliament tomorrow as they ramp up their fight to keep ticket offices open.
Transport union RMT is already planning two 48-hour strikes in February to protect services for the travelling public and will protest outside the Commons before MPs debate the closures and loss of several hundred safety-critical jobs.
Labour MP and RMT parliamentary group convenor John McDonnell secured the Westminster Hall debate.
